Gnomestone Posted July 22, 2009 Author Report Share Posted July 22, 2009 Alright I fixed the user-mapped section open error. Before I get into anything else, I'll tell you how I fixed it. Webroot has 4 critical shields, when you turn gamer mode on, it turns 3 of 4 critical shields off. The one that it doesn't turn off is "Execution Shield". There is an option that you can check saying "Turn Execution Shield off when you turn Gamer Mode on". I check the box, everytime I download torrents, I turn gamer mode on and I haven't gotten the error since.Ironically enough, I have been getting a new error saying "The process cannot access the file because it's being used by another process". This error occurs less often then the user-mapped section open error. I am able to force start it to continue the torrent. If you have any information on this error please let me know.
